服务器监控软件有哪些好用
在现代的信息技术时代,服务器作为支撑网站、应用程序和数据存储的核心设备,扮演着至关重要的角色。服务器运行中出现问题是不可避免的,并且这些问题可能会导致服务中断、数据损失以及用户体验下降等严重后果。为了保障服务器稳定运行并及时发现潜在故障,使用一款优秀的服务器监控软件是非常必要的。
(图片来源网络,侵删)1. NagiosNagios 是一款功能强大且广泛应用于企业级环境中的开源监控软件。它具有灵活性高、可自定义性强等特点,在全球范围内被广泛采纳和使用。Nagios 可以对网络设备、主机状态、服务状态进行实时监测,并通过邮件或短信等方式向管理员发送警报通知。
2. ZabbixZabbix 是另一款流行且功能齐全的开源监控解决方案。它提供了实时监测、报警通知、历史数据分析等多种功能模块,并支持各种操作系统和网络设备类型。Zabbix 还可以通过图表和仪表盘展示监控数据,方便管理员进行可视化分析。
3. PrometheusPrometheus 是一款开源的时间序列数据库和监控系统。它具有高度灵活性和可扩展性,可以实时收集、存储和分析大规模服务器集群的指标数据。Prometheus 还支持多种报警方式,并提供了强大的查询语言 PromQL,使得管理员能够更加精细地定义自己关心的指标并进行监测。
(图片来源网络,侵删)4. SolarWinds Server & Application MonitorSolarWinds 提供了一系列功能全面且易于使用的服务器监控软件。其 Server & Application Monitor 可以对整个 IT 基础设施进行端到端监测,并提供详细的性能统计、事件日志分析等功能。SolarWinds 还有许多其他管理工具如 Network Performance Monitor 和 Database Performance Analyzer 等。
5. PRTG Network MonitorPRTG 是一款基于 Web 的网络监控软件,也适用于服务器监控。通过使用各种传感器来收集不同类型设备上的数据,并将这些数据转换为易读且直观呈现在用户界面上。PRTG 支持 SNMP、WMI、SSH 等协议,并提供预置模板以简化配置过程。
以上仅是几款知名而好用的服务器监控软件,每种软件都有其独特的优点和适用场景。在选择时,可以根据自身需求、预算以及技术要求来进行权衡。
(图片来源网络,侵删)无论使用哪款服务器监控软件,在部署前应先了解其功能特性,并根据实际情况进行配置和调整。通过合理设置监控项、报警规则和数据展示方式,管理员能够更好地保障服务器的稳定运行并提升工作效率。